The Graywick validator plugin system loads modules from the registry at startup. If a customer reports validation rules silently skipping, check whether their plugin manifest version matches the running Graywick core; mismatches are logged but not fatal. Restarting the worker pool forces a clean plugin reload. For persistent failures, capture the worker log and file an escalation, making sure to include the plugin load trace token printed below.

pipeline stamp: htk9_ce63042d9

// Broker upgrade notes — Quindle 3.x migration (for the release manager)
//
// This client is pinned to the Quindle 3.2 wire protocol. During the
// upgrade window, the old 2.9 brokers in the Ashmere cluster will still
// accept publishes, but acknowledgements differ: 3.x confirms per-batch,
// not per-message. Do not flip the canary flag until all consumers in
// the Torvane fleet report protocol 3 readiness.
// The setup below connects to the internal Quindle control plane and
// authenticates with the key immediately following this block.

service key, fawip-bajef: kto11_Qt5wZK9vdNC

## 2.14.0 — Changed defaults

The Ledgerbeam payments service had persistently flaky integration tests caused by aggressive retry and timeout defaults. We raised the gateway timeout, disabled retry jitter in test mode, and pinned the sandbox clock. CI pass rates stabilized after two weeks of observation, so these are now the shipped defaults rather than test overrides. For reference, the current effective configuration is reproduced below.

service settings:
[norax]
team = zormir
access_code = ac_c302d9
owner = ralmir.zorox
host = norax.zarqeltech.internal
port = 11211
peer = praion.halixlabs.example
salt = 9c2a54f3
pin = 9824

## Environments: cron drift investigation

During the Pellgrove drift investigation we confirmed that staging and prod run different NTP sync intervals, which explains the four-minute skew in nightly job start times. Staging hosts were provisioned from an older image that never got the updated timing profile. Until the image is rebuilt, releases should not rely on cross-environment timestamp comparisons. For reference, the current timing configuration on each environment is recorded below.

service settings:
[casax]
port = 6379
team = rusir
host = casax.zemvarhq.corp
region = outer-4
access_code = ac_9808ce
timeout_ms = 1500